iPhone and iPod Touch exercise and bundle updates …

I’ve just added and/or updated the following exercise packages for the iPhone and/or iPod Touch: Cydia Packager apps for the 2.0 (and early) firmware: [upd] Dock (3.20) [Deeds with 2.1 and concealed apps; rock-bottom storage device activity; back up field in Prefs app.] -ste
 

iPhone and iPod Touch exercise and bundle updates …

I’ve just added and/or updated the following exercise packages for the iPhone and/or iPod Touch: Cydia Packager apps for the 2.0 (and early) firmware: [upd] Dock (3.20) [Deeds with 2.1 and concealed apps; rock-bottom storage device activity; back up field in Prefs app.] -ste
 

iPhone and iPod Touch exercise and bundle updates …

I’ve just added and/or updated the following exercise packages for the iPhone and/or iPod Touch: Cydia Packager apps for the 2.0 (and early) firmware: [upd] Dock (3.20) [Deeds with 2.1 and concealed apps; rock-bottom storage device activity; back up field in Prefs app.] -ste
 

iPhone and iPod Touch exercise and bundle updates …

I’ve just added and/or updated the following exercise packages for the iPhone and/or iPod Touch: Cydia Packager apps for the 2.0 (and early) firmware: [upd] Dock (3.20) [Deeds with 2.1 and concealed apps; rock-bottom storage device activity; back up field in Prefs app.] -ste
 

Stipendiary Down Your Technical Indebtedness

Every software system project I've ever worked on has accrued technical debt concluded time:

Technical Indebtedness is a marvellous figure of speech developed by Ward Cunningham to help us think about this question. In this figure of speech, doing belongings the quick and dirty way sets us up with a technical indebtedness, which is like to a financial indebtedness. Like a financial indebtedness, the technical indebtedness incurs interest payments, which come in the form of the redundant exertion that we have to do in future development because of the quick and dirty design decision making. We can decide to continue stipendiary the interest, or we can pay down the financier by refactoring the quick and dirty design into the better design. Although it reimbursement to pay down the financier, we gain by rock-bottom interest payments in the future.

The figure of speech also explains wherefore it Gregorian calendar month be insensible to do the quick and dirty approach. Just as a business incurs no indebtedness to take point of a market possibleness developers Gregorian calendar month get technical indebtedness to hit an influential point in time. The no too common question is that development organizations let their indebtedness get out of control and eat least of their future development exertion stipendiary unhealthful interest payments.

No matter how untalented and smart the software system developers, no these petite deferments begin to add up and cumulatively matter on the project, effortful it down. My word project is no dissimilar. Aft half a dozen solid months excavation on the Stack Spill over codebase, this is exactly where we square measure. We're dig in our heels and retrenching for a major refactoring of our info. We have to stop excavation on new features for a spell and pay down no of our technical debt.

credit game

I disbelieve that accruing technical indebtedness is ineluctable on some real software system project. Sure, you refactor as you go, and disintegrate improvements when you can -- but it's impossible action to presage exactly how those key decisions you ready-made early on in the project square measure exit to play out. No you can do is roll with the punches, and fund no time into the programme to periodically pay down your technical debt.

The time you take out of the programme to make technical indebtedness payments typically doesn't resultant role in thing the customers or users will see. This can sometimes be hard to apologize. In construct, I had to defend our result with Book, my business spouse. He'd pay we work on no crazy thing he calls revenue generation, some that is.

Steve McConnell has a lengthy communicate launching examining technical debt. The perils of not ackowledging your indebtedness square measure clear:

One of the influential implications of technical indebtedness is that it mustiness be serviced, i.e., once you get a indebtedness here will be interest charges. If the indebtedness grows large decent, eventually the company will eat more than on pairing its indebtedness than it invests in decreasing the value of its otherwise assets. A common mental representation is a legacy encrypt base in which so little work goes into conformation a production system running (i.e., "pairing the indebtedness") that here is little time left concluded to add new capabilities to the system. With financial indebtedness, analysts talk about the "indebtedness magnitude relation," which is quits to total indebtedness divided by total possession. High indebtedness ratios square measure seen as more than high-risk, which seems true for technical indebtedness, too.

Beyond what Steve describes Hera, I'd also present that accumulated technical indebtedness becomes a major incentive to work on a project. It's a request of small but mistreatment belongings that you have to deal with all time you sit down to write encrypt. But it's exactly these small annoyances, this soil rubbing away in the gears of your rest day, that eventually causes you to stop enjoying the project. These small belongings matter.

It can be shivery to go in and rebuild a lot of excavation encrypt that has transmute crufty concluded time. But don't give-up the ghost to fear.

I mustiness not fear. Fear is the mind-killer. Fear is the little-death that brings total obliteration. I will face my fear. I will Trachinotus falcatus it to pass concluded me and done me. And when it has lost past I will turn the central eyeball to see its path. Where the fear has lost here will be nothing. Only I will remain.

When it comes time to pay down your technical indebtedness, don't be horror-struck to break stuff. It's liberating, even kinetic to tear down encrypt in order to build it up stronger and better than it was before. Be timid, and realise that stipendiary your technical indebtedness all so often is a mean, necessity part of the software system development cycle to forestall large interest payments early. Aft no, who wants to live forever?

[advertisement] Change Your Source Encrypt Management victimisation Atlassian Fisheye - Monitor. Search. Share. Psychoanalyze. Try it for free!